Job Purpose:
This is a senior security analyst role on the Caterpillar Cybersecurity Vulnerability Management Team and is focused on delivery of security subject matter expertise for the advancement, execution and sustainability of the Cybersecurity Vulnerability Management Programs.
Description:
Job Duties/Responsibilities:
- Provide strategic/thought leadership on maturing and optimizing Vulnerability Management Programs focused on infrastructure security and protection (VMI).
- Maintain clear ownership and daily accountability of VMI security operational processes and technologies.
- Provide direction and support of operational tools and processes for identifying and communicating vulnerable items for Vulnerability Management Infrastructure (VMI).
- Provide input and support to leaders/peers from architecture, engineering, and IT operations on architecting tools and solutions related to vulnerability and secure configuration management.
- Obtain and maintain knowledge on existing security procedures and directives related to vulnerability management.
- Provide overview of services and status of key project to stakeholders and security leadership.
- SME and/or key contributor on team deliverables and key projects. Provide oversight for VM activities such as; new tool implementation/investigation, significant changes, and process improvements.
- Develop and report on metrics to departmental and business unit leaders & stakeholders.
- Maintenance and configuration of API's for creating vulnerability groups in ServiceNow
- Develop and maintain workflows in ServiceNow related to vulnerability management remediation processes.
- Interface with IT Operations staff and leadership to drive efficiency into vulnerability management processes in ServiceNow
- Educate Caterpillar workforce on VMI operational processes to ensure successful execution.
